In his follow-up to the criminally comic Lock, Stock, and Two Smoking Barrels, Guy Ritchie weaves illegal dogfights, underground boxing, Russian arms dealers, and Jewish gem merchants into an intricate story of a diamond heist in London’s Hatton Garden jewelry district.
